Abstract

Background: Kinesio taping (KT) has become of interest in the management of brachial plexus birth palsy (BPBP). Accordingly, this is the first systematic review to explicitly report the effect of KT on BPBP.Objective: To systematically review the effectiveness of kinesio taping on improving upper limb motor function in children with brachial plexus injury.Method: Articles were identified through searches of the following databases:PubMed, The Cochrane Library, OVID, Web of Science, Science Direct and Google scholar till June 2018. We expanded our search to all research designs except expert opinions and non-peer reviewed publications. The methodological quality of studies was assessed using Methodological Index for Nonrandomized Studies (MINORS).The National Health and Medical Research Council (NHMRC) was used to assess the level of evidence. Result: Five studies met our inclusion criteria. All the included studies reported a significant improvement in body structure, function and activity as a result of using kinesiotaping except two studies that showed no significant improvement in performance during activity
